Bill Summary
This resolution rejects and opposes engaging Russia as a main intermediary for reviving any nuclear agreement with Iran. The resolution rejects and opposes giving Russia any sanctions exemption or waiver as a condition to any nuclear agreement with Iran. The resolution rejects and opposes any agreement that lifts sanctions on Iran and legitimizes the regime's illicit nuclear program amidst an International Atomic Energy Agency investigation...
